Margarita Kalcheva-Bulgaria

Margarita Kalcheva was born in Pleven, Bulgaria. She graduated from the “Panayot Pipkov” Secondary School with a degree in Irina Petrova and the National Academy of Music “Prof. P. Vladigerov ”in the double bass class of Professor Todor Toshev. She attended master classes with Prof. Victor Chuchkov and Michel Veyon.

Since 1998, Margarita has been the leader of the double bass group in the BNR Symphony Orchestra. Since 2009 she has been the conductor of double basses in the Orchestra Ensemble Kanazawa – Japan. She maintains her international profile and career as a soloist, chamber and orchestral double bass player around the world.

Her repertoire includes Botezini, Dittersdorf, Kusewicki, Tchaikovsky, Goleminov, Tabakov.

She has made numerous recordings and premieres, including a solo concert in Japan (2012), Rococo-Tchaikovsky Variations, Double Bass Concerto-Goleminov, Breavisimo -E. Morricone, “Yellow-Green” – D. Hristov.

Since 2015 she has been a lecturer at the Summer Academy – Sozopol with students from Bulgaria, Japan, Panama, Turkey, Germany.

In 2018 she started her double bass class at the New Bulgarian University-Sofia.
